Output 595c80d4ab8a3f92ae61b54ba1b2d582d29e8500cd5be4aedc10a37dcbe35f7e:1

value
2582392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2fd01c701b2a369e0a8a2e90286eed8e5fba31 OP_EQUAL
address
3Qs2qNPVDFfFbmjegmrfDhYjJPSDdMAQSN
transaction
595c80d4ab8a3f92ae61b54ba1b2d582d29e8500cd5be4aedc10a37dcbe35f7e
confirmations
519134
spent
true